Abstract

The closure plug (1) has an elastic clamping sleeve (16) fastened to an inner side (13) of a sealing cap disk (14). The sleeve has an annular locking element (18) radially protruded into the cavity to lock the sleeve with a ring segment-like counter-locking element (19). Outer diameter (D1) of the locking element is approximately equal to diameter (D2) of a cylinder segment-like inner wall (21) such that the locking element at an inner end (17) of the sleeve is guided before locking with the counter-locking element by the inner wall during fixing a sealing cap (5) on a bung-hole plug (4).

When the sealing cap is snapped onto the bung plug screwed into the bung of a bung container, the elastic legs of the sealing cap dip into the plug well and the leg feet lock with radial undercuts formed at the base of the key engagement eyelets. The outer diameter of the circularly arranged leg feet of the sealing cap is greater than the inner diameter of the circularly arranged, outwardly curved inner walls of the key gripping lugs of the bung plug with the undercuts for engaging the leg feet of the sealing cap. This geometry of the sealing plug and the Sealing cap leads to difficulties in snapping the seal cap on the stopper in automatic filling systems for liquids, since at the beginning of Aufrastvorgangs the elastic legs of the sealing cap with the locking feet on the upper edge of the key gripping lugs of the bung of the container to be closed hitting and not through the inner walls of the key gripping eyelets the bung stopper are guided but first must be compressed so far that the locking feet can engage with the inner walls of the key locking eyelets.
